Nayara Springs Joins Relais & Châteaux

Nayara Springs, the adults-only luxury resort in the rainforest of Costa Rica’s Arenal Volcano, has joined the worldwide boutique hotel collection of Relais & Châteaux, which now has over 500 properties in 60 countries.

The eco-friendly rainforest retreat is now partners with three hotel collections, Virtuoso and Fine Hotels & Resorts being the other two.

Additionally, Nayara Springs announced new experiences and amenities guests can enjoy during their stay:

  • Coffee-lovers can see the journey from bean to cup at Nayara Springs. Guests can pick their own coffee beans at a local coffee farm, learn to roast them at the resort’s new espresso bar, Mi Cafecito, create their own custom blend, and finish off with a bag of their personal blend to take home.
  • The resort’s new Spanish Immersion Package allows guests to hone their Spanish language skills during their stay. The program includes a number of Spanish-language books available in-room, Spanish lessons, and a Spanish lunch with a resort host.
  • Nayara’s new Sloth Sanctuary provides a safe home for over 15 sloths, after the planting of 300 Cacropia trees on property, the sloth’s main food source.

Nayara Springs is a part of Nayara Resorts, a collection of two properties set in Arenal Volcano National Park – Nayara Resort, Spa & Gardens and Nayara Springs.

In 2017, Nayara Springs expanded its facilities and now offers 35 luxury villas with views of the Arenal Volcano. Each villa is equipped with a private pool fed by mineral hot springs and a private garden with exterior shower, four-poster bed, and indoor and outdoor sitting areas. Nayara Springs is connected to its sister hotel Nayara Resort, Spa & Gardens by footbridge.
